It Is Btiid that one inortiitig at break fast a Koneral related to the emperor the misfortunes of a brither olllc.-r who "because he had not l.'.OOO francs must be dishonored." While the em peror questioned further particulars Eugntile flew to her room and, return ing with a package of banknotes, ssld, "Take them, general, and never tell tne Ids name." And his name the geu Toua empress never knew. Forethought. "Bight here," said the surveyor, "will he a good place for your saw mill. The county line will run exactly tlirougb the middle of It." "Not much," aald the pioneer. "We'll hava It all on one side or the other. When a man gets sawed In two, I fion't want no two coroners' Inquests over hlin." Chicago Tribune. An Injrrraoll Slorr.
